The captain is a USCG-certified captain and Licensed Wisconsin Fishing Guide. You will be given a chance to catch the fish of a lifetime! Port Washington has world-class fishing in the Great Lakes including King Salmon, Coho Salmon, Lake Trout, Brown Trout, and Steelhead Trout (Rainbow Trout).
Everyone age 16 and over is required to have a valid Wisconsin fishing license. In addition, you will need a Great Lakes Fishing Stamp if fishing for Salmon or Trout. You need to have a paper copy of your license while fishing Lake Michigan.
Make sure to bring season-appropriate clothing. Also, bring rain gear if needed, or sunglasses and sunblock. Pack a cooler with ice to take your catch home, and a small cooler with any lunch, snacks, or beverages you want to bring.
